پاورپوینت استفاده ازالگوریتمهای الهام گرفته از کلونی مورچه ها در مسیریابی شبکه های کامپیوتری

پاورپوینت استفاده ازالگوریتمهای الهام گرفته از کلونی مورچه ها در مسیریابی شبکه های کامپیوتری


فهرست مطالب

مروری بر مسیریابی در شبکه های کامپیوتری

هوش جمعی (swarm Intelligence)

مسیریابی با الهام از کلونی مورچه ها

AntNet CL

AntNet CO

شبیه سازی AntNet CO

مقایسه AntNet با روشهای معمول  مسیریابی


مروری بر مسیریابی در شبکه های کامپیوتری

نیازهای حاصل از رشد شبکه های ارتباطی

افزایش کارآیی

مدیریت توزیع شده

معیارهای موثر در ارزیابی روشهای “مسیریابی”

Throughput

Average Delay of packets

ویژگی خاص مساله “مسیریابی”

عدم قطعیت (Stochastic)

پویایی (Dynamic)

مشکل روشهای موجود (RIP ,OSPF)

توزیع بار (Load Balancing)

مسائل یادگیری تقویتی با حالت پنهان و روشهای حل آنها

Q-Learning

Ant Colony Systems


هوش جمعی (swarm Intelligence)

Emergent  Intelligence

تعاملات محلی ، محدود و ساده اعضای یک دسته و جمعیت  با محیط ، منتهی به یک رفتار جمعی هوشمندانه می شود

این تعاملات غالبا غریزی بوده وبدون نظارت انجام می گیرند

نتیجه آن غالبا یک رفتار پیچیده و هوشمندانه جمعی و بطور خاص انجام بعضی بهینه سازی های پیچیده است

این نوع هوشمندی هیچ نیازی به کنترل مرکزی و دید کلی نسبت به سیستم ندارد

Stigmergy : ایده اصلی در تعاملات

ارتباط با واسطه محیط

 لانه سازی موریانه ها

 ترشح اسید فرمیک توسط مورچه ها

مزایایی که هوش جمعی از آن بهره می برند

مقیاس پذیری(scalability)

تعاملات توزیع شده موجودات

خطا پذیری(Fault tolerance)

عدم وجود کنترل متمرکز

قابلیت تطبیق پذیری عاملها

سرعت انتقال تغییر

تفکیک پذیری (modularity)

خودکار بودن سیستم : نیاز به نظارت انسان نیست

کارکرد موازی

دانلود فایل